    Quoted from ChiroCop:

    A gentleman on Pinside posted his shipping manifest awhile back. He ordered an AFMr from his distributor's warehouse. His NIB Pinball machine hit a dozen or more cities/locations before finally arriving at his house. Lots of loading/unloading. No surprise the box looked like it went 7 rounds with Mike Tyson...and consequently had to be put back on the truck...due to damage. Poor guy had to wait several more weeks to get his Pin.
    Questions for you experienced guys :
    1.) Do you prefer your NIB to be directly shipped from manufacturer? Fewer hands touching it.
    2.) Have you ever refused a NIB Pin due to damage?
    3.) How much inspection can/do you perform before signing the paperwork?
    Delivery truck drivers are pretty fast at pushing a pen and paperwork in front of your face. Your insight is much appreciated by the way. Trying to figure out how much I can push back when the box looks crumpled...and the driver acts like I'm putting him behind schedule.

    Are there in distributers in texas? You buy from a local dist and most of these problems should go away as you can pick one up from them.
